Martin Luther King Jr Dept: Obama s glitzy public swearing-in took place on the national holiday devoted to revered civil rights leader Martin Luther King Jr, according to The Chronicle Herald. One of Obama s appointees to the Supreme Court, Sonia Sotomayor, administered the oath to Vice President Joe Biden on Monday as the president beamed. Roberts, who famously flubbed the oath of office in 2009, swore in Obama without any hitches this time and wASHINGTON U.S. President Barack Obama took the oath of office for the second time in as many days on Monday, this time before as many as 800,000 jubilant Americans who cheered as he urged Americans to come together and uphold cherished U.S. principles of justice and equality. On Sunday, America s first African-American president was sworn in by John Roberts, chief justice of the U.S. Supreme Court, during an intimate ceremony at the White House due to a U.S. constitutional requirement that presidents to take the oath of office on Jan. 20. When the 20th falls on a Sunday, the public festivities are held the next day. (www.immigrantscanada.com). As reported in the news.
